CBA, ANZ to Settle 2016 Lawsuit Involving BBSW Manipulation
Editors, Regulation Asia, 23 March 2021
The case was initially launched by two US hedge funds and a US-based derivatives trader, alleging they suffered losses due to bank manipulation of the BBSW.
CBA (Commonwealth Bank of Australia) and ANZ Bank have separately issued statements saying they have reached an agreement to settle a class action brought against them in the US in 2016 involving the trading of certain BBSW-based products.
